India, the defending champions, have officially unveiled their 15-member squad for the ICC Men’s T20 World Cup 2026. The selection reflects a blend of experience, domestic form, and tactical flexibility as India aims to lift the trophy on home soil for a record third time. Olympics+1

🗓 Looking Forward

India are set to begin preparations with a 5-match T20I series against New Zealand in January 2026, using the same squad — a warm-up ahead of the World Cup. Outlook India

With home advantage and a deeply talented squad, all eyes will be on India as they aim to defend their title and continue their formidable T20 legacy.
